At BWX Technologies, Inc. (NYSE: BWXT), we are People Strong, Innovation Driven. Headquartered in Lynchburg, Va., BWXT provides safe and effective nuclear solutions for national security, clean energy, environmental remediation, nuclear medicine and space exploration. With approximately 6,650 employees, BWXT has 12 major operating sites in the U.S. and Canada. We are the sole manufacturer of naval nuclear reactors for U.S. submarines and aircraft carriers. Our company supplies precision manufactured components, services and fuel for the commercial nuclear power industry across four continents. Our joint ventures provide environmental remediation and nuclear operations management at more than a dozen U.S. Department of Energy and NASA facilities. BWXT's technology is driving advances in medical radioisotope production in North America and microreactors for various defense and space applications. Engineer 4 - (Advisory Engineering) Nuclear Fuel Services (BWXT) - Erwin, TN

Summary Description of Job:

Under the general supervision of the manager, has technical responsibility for manufacturing, quality control, or subcontractor processes that must yield acceptable product. May supervise other engineers and technicians engaged in mutual technical work. Applies intensive and diversified knowledge of engineering principles and practices in broad areas of assignments. Makes decisions to resolve important questions and to plan and coordinate work. Requires the use of advanced techniques and the modification and extension of theories, precepts, and practices of the field and related sciences. Supervision and guidance related largely to overall objectives, critical issues, new concepts, and policy matters.

  • Plans, develops, and coordinates a large and important engineering project or a number of small projects.
  • Performs complex or novel assignments requiring the development of new or improved techniques and procedures.
  • May develop and evaluate plans and criteria for a variety of projects and activities to be carried out by others.
  • Assesses the feasibility and soundness of proposed engineering evaluation tests, equipment or quality control systems.
  • Organizes own work and that of other engineers and technicians who may be assigned as assistants on projects.
  • Estimates personnel needs and schedules and assigns work to meet completion dates.
  • Provides the technical expertise necessary for making mature and sound engineering or quality control judgments.
  • Anticipates and resolves unprecedented engineering problems.
  • Provides periodic written reports outlining work to date, problems encountered, and solutions found to be effective.
  • Provides the necessary interface between departments to resolve problems affecting assigned projects.
  • Performs assigned work in a timely manner with a high degree of accuracy.
  • Assists in the training of new engineering personnel.

Educational Requirements of Job:

  • B. S. -- Engineering (from an ABET accredited institution)

Experience Requirements of Job (Beyond educational or equivalent requirements):

  • Seven years' engineering experience since B. S. degree (six years with M.S. degree)

Additional Position Requirements:

  • Ability to effectively communicate complex technical information in writing and verbally.
  • Ability to work both independently and as part of a multifunctional team.
  • Performance of Engineering Design Authority role with responsibility of approving plant modifications and ownership of the technical design requirements for plant.
  • Experience in plant systems and processes in nuclear facility.
  • Knowledge/experience in reviewing design documents as it relates to configuration control/management of change for physical plant modifications.
  • Familiarity with ANSI/DOE standards for Configuration Management of Nuclear Facilities.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ain a DOE security clearance.
  • Must be a U.S. citizen with no dual citizenship.
